数据库空值加数等于什么

worktile 其他 3

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库中的空值加任何数的结果都是空值。

    在数据库中,空值表示缺失或未知的值。它不同于具体的数值或字符串,因为它没有具体的值。当我们对一个空值进行加法运算时,无法确定空值的具体数值,因此结果也会是空值。

    下面是关于数据库空值加数的一些重要事实:

    1. 空值加数等于空值:无论加数是什么数值,空值加上任何数都会得到空值作为结果。

    2. 空值加0等于空值:加0实际上不会改变空值的值,所以结果仍然是空值。

    3. 空值加非空值等于空值:无论加数是什么数值,如果其中一个是空值,结果都会是空值。

    4. 空值加空值等于空值:如果两个加数都是空值,那么结果仍然是空值。

    5. 空值加负数等于空值:负数是具体的数值,但当它与空值相加时,结果仍然是空值。

    在数据库中,处理空值需要特别小心。因为空值的存在可能导致计算的不确定性和错误的结果。在查询和计算中,我们需要使用特殊的函数和操作符来处理空值,例如IS NULL、IS NOT NULL、COALESCE等。

    总之,数据库中的空值加任何数的结果都是空值。处理空值时需要注意,避免产生不确定性和错误的结果。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库空值加数等于空值。在数据库中,空值表示缺少值或未知值。当一个数值字段或表达式与空值相加时,结果仍然是空值。这是因为在数学运算中,任何数字与未知值相加的结果仍然是未知的。因此,空值加数等于空值。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在数据库中,空值加上任何数的结果都是空值。这是因为空值表示缺少值或未知值,无法与其他数值进行运算。在数据库中,空值是一个特殊的值,用来表示缺失或未知的数据。

    当我们对一个空值进行加法运算时,无法确定空值的具体值,因此无法得出准确的结果。数据库系统会将这种运算结果定义为空值,表示无法确定的结果。

    下面是一个示例来说明空值加数的结果是空值:

    假设我们有一个包含两列的表格,分别是"Number1"和"Number2":

    Number1 Number2
    5 10
    NULL 20
    7 NULL
    NULL NULL

    现在,我们尝试对这个表格中的每一行进行加法运算:

    1. 第一行:5 + 10 = 15
    2. 第二行:NULL + 20 = NULL
    3. 第三行:7 + NULL = NULL
    4. 第四行:NULL + NULL = NULL

    可以看到,无论是与非空值还是与空值进行加法运算,结果都是空值。这是因为在数据库中,空值表示未知或缺失的值,无法与其他数值进行运算得出确定的结果。

    总结起来,数据库中的空值加数的结果总是空值。在进行计算或比较操作时,需要特别注意处理空值的情况,以避免出现意外的结果。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部